<br />City Council or Council - The City Council of the City of Centerville. <br /> <br />Clear Cutting - The indiscriminate removal of trees, shrubs, or undergrowth with the <br />intention of preparing real property for non-agricultural development purposes. This <br />definition shall not include the selective removal of non-native tree and shrub species when <br />the soil is left relatively undisturbed, removal of dead trees or normal mowing operations. <br /> <br />Clinic - Any establishment where human patients are examined and treated by doctors or <br />dentists but not hospitalized overnight. <br /> <br />Club - Any establishment operated for social, recreational, or educational purposes but <br />open only to members and not the general public. <br /> <br />Cluster Housing - The grouping of single-family dwellings within specified areas while <br />maintaining the same overall allowable density in that same area. <br /> <br />Commercial Use - An occupation, employment, or enterprise that is carried on for profit by <br />the owner, lessee, or licensee. <br /> <br />Commission - The Planning and Zoning Commission of the City of Centerville. <br /> <br />Commissioner - A member of the Planning and Zoning Commission. <br /> <br />Comprehensive Plan - A compilation of policy statements, goals, standards and maps for <br />guiding the physical, social and economic development of the City and including a land use <br />plan, a community facilities plan and a transportation plan which has been prepared and <br />adopted by the City of Centerville. <br /> <br />Conditional Use - A use, which because of special problems of control requires <br />reasonable limitations peculiar to the use for the protection of the public welfare and the <br />integrity of the Comprehensive Plan. <br /> <br />Conditional Use Permit - A permit, issued by the Council, in accordance with procedures <br />specified in this Ordinance as a flexibility device to enable the council to assign dimensions <br />to a proposed use or conditions surrounding it after consideration of adjacent uses and their <br />functions and the special problems which the proposed use permits. <br /> <br />Contractors Yard - An area where vehicles, equipment and/or construction materials and <br />supplies commonly used by building, excavation, roadway construction and similar <br />contractors are stored or serviced.
